изменение сi-cd 12

This commit is contained in:
Kayashov.SM
2025-04-25 11:29:18 +04:00
parent 2cdcf67894
commit ef07ac0105

View File

@@ -6,7 +6,7 @@ services:
stages:
- stop-old
- build
- docker
- deploy
stop-job:
@@ -29,20 +29,16 @@ maven-build:
- target/*.jar
docker-build:
stage: docker
stage: build
only:
- master
- back_release
script:
- docker login -u gitlab-ci-token -p $CI_JOB_TOKEN http://192.168.1.100:9093
- docker build -t gitlab.kayashov.keenetic.pro/kayashov/my-bar .
- docker push gitlab.kayashov.keenetic.pro/kayashov/my-bar
- docker build -t my-bar .
build-job:
stage: docker
deploy-job:
stage: deploy
script:
- echo "Compiling the code..."
- docker login -u gitlab-ci-token -p $CI_JOB_TOKEN https://gitlab.kayashov.keenetic.pro
- docker run --name my-bar --restart=always -p 8091:8080 -d gitlab.kayashov.keenetic.pro/kayashov/my-bar
- echo "Compile complete
- docker run --name my-bar --restart=always -p 8091:8080 -d my-bar
- echo "Deploy complete"
only:
- back_release